A rooftop bar and restaurant that both opened months ago in South Boston have been shuttered "for the foreseeable future," the company said in a social media post .
The Essex, located at The Cambria Hotel at 6 West Broadway, announced the sudden closure on Instagram this week.
The lobby-level restaurant had just opened in March, while the rooftop bar, The Essex Rooftop, had opened in May, according to the social media page.
For a few months, The Essex served up dishes like squid ink spaghetti, gazpacho, and za'atar-seasoned fries downstairs. The Essex Rooftop offered small bites such as cocktail shrimp and charcuterie in addition to elaborate beverages.
